I try to remember to run all the accessories on a vehicle after I've done any service or install work. That usually means lights, PA, siren, etc. With more and more public safety vehicles using LED lightning, it's becoming a bigger risk. Most higher end lights are designed to not create the noise, or at least not dump it back into the electrical system.
Would be interesting to know if the LED's are powered off the 24v -> 12v converter, or if they wired them to the 24 volt system. Usually LED's will operate over a pretty wide voltage, so it's probably not necessary.
